Pull Request Overview
This PR optimizes relation selections by introducing a conditional approach to avoid unnecessary nested queries when simple joins suffice. The optimization reduces query complexity while maintaining the same functionality.
- Introduces
canJoinWithoutNestedSelect()method to determine when simple joins can be used instead of nested subqueries - Refactors SQLite and PostgreSQL dialects to use direct joins when possible, falling back to nested queries only when required
- Extracts common join filter logic into reusable methods and updates column alias naming for consistency

packages/runtime/src/client/crud/dialects/postgresql.ts (1)
244-271: Bug: missing alias for scalar fields in selective projectionFor the selective branch, non-relation fields call fieldRef with undefined alias. This can produce invalid/ambiguous column refs since the relation is aliased (relationModelAlias).
Apply this diff:
- const fieldDef = requireField(this.schema, relationModel, field); - const fieldValue = fieldDef.relation - ? // reference the synthesized JSON field - eb.ref(`${parentResultName}$${field}.$data`) - : // reference a plain field - this.fieldRef(relationModel, field, eb, undefined, false); + const fieldDef = requireField(this.schema, relationModel, field); + const fieldValue = fieldDef.relation + ? // reference the synthesized JSON field + eb.ref(`${parentResultName}$${field}.$data`) + : // reference a plain field using the correct table alias + this.fieldRef(relationModel, field, eb, relationModelAlias, false);

204-252: Join-filter centralization is correct; consider EXISTS for M2MLogic for M2M and FK relations is correct. For large join tables, EXISTS can be more index-friendly than IN.
Proposed alternative for the M2M branch:
- selectModelQuery = selectModelQuery.where((eb) => - eb( - eb.ref(`${relationModelAlias}.${relationIds[0]}`), - 'in', - eb - .selectFrom(m2m.joinTable) - .select(`${m2m.joinTable}.${m2m.otherFkName}`) - .whereRef(`${parentAlias}.${parentIds[0]}`, '=', `${m2m.joinTable}.${m2m.parentFkName}`), - ), - ); + selectModelQuery = selectModelQuery.where((eb) => + eb.exists( + eb + .selectFrom(m2m.joinTable) + .select((eb2) => eb2.val(1)) + .whereRef(`${parentAlias}.${parentIds[0]}`, '=', `${m2m.joinTable}.${m2m.parentFkName}`) + .whereRef(`${relationModelAlias}.${relationIds[0]}`, '=', `${m2m.joinTable}.${m2m.otherFkName}`), + ), + );
